Neighborhood Overview
Madison Middle School is situated in the friendly, residential Bethel neighborhood on the western edge of Eugene. Access is primarily achieved via Wilkes Drive, which connects easily to major regional arteries like Beltline Highway for those traveling from outside the city. The school grounds feature dedicated lot parking that accommodates standard event traffic, though visitors should anticipate tighter spots during peak school hours or popular weekend tournaments. Eugene Airport (EUG) is the nearest major aviation hub, located approximately a 15-minute drive to the north of the campus.
Navigating the area is straightforward, as the neighborhood maintains a suburban rhythm that is generally easy to traverse by car. While public transit options exist via Lane Transit District buses, most attendees find that personal vehicles or rideshare services offer the most flexibility for transporting gear or equipment. Smart arrival tactics include planning to reach the venue at least 30 minutes before your scheduled start time to secure a convenient parking space near the fields. If you are arriving during weekday afternoon hours, be mindful of local school dismissal traffic which can create temporary bottlenecks on nearby residential streets.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winters in Eugene are cool and damp, with frequent cloud cover and occasional light rain. Visitors should pack waterproof jackets, warm layers, and sturdy, comfortable footwear for navigating the grounds. Events during this time are often held indoors, so plan accordingly for indoor athletic environments.
Spring & early summer
This is a beautiful time of year as the region comes alive with blooming greenery and mild temperatures. It is perfect for outdoor events, though visitors should remain prepared for sudden spring showers. Dressing in light, removable layers is the best strategy for staying comfortable throughout the day.
Mid-summer
Summers are typically warm and dry with plenty of sunshine, making it an ideal time for outdoor competitions. Be sure to pack sunscreen, hats, and plenty of water to stay hydrated during long days on the fields. Portable shade is highly recommended for any group setting up a base camp.
Fall season
Fall brings crisp, cool mornings and comfortable afternoons, creating a pleasant atmosphere for sports and school activities. The changing leaves provide a beautiful backdrop for your visit, though temperatures can drop quickly once the sun goes down. A medium-weight jacket is essential for staying comfortable during late-afternoon and evening events.
Rain & snow
Rain is a common feature of the Pacific Northwest and can occur at any time outside of the summer months. Always keep rain gear, including umbrellas and ponchos, in your vehicle just in case. Snow is rare in the valley but can occur, so check local forecasts before traveling during the colder months.
